Faulty Locks
While a lock malfunction is never a good idea It is important not to be in a panic or delay getting it fixed. It may appear to be a minor problem but a broken lock can have serious consequences for the security of your home. Many homeowners ignore door lock problems until they experience a break-in or suffer damages that they could have avoided if they had addressed the issue earlier.
It is not unusual for keys to stop turning inside the lock in the cylinder. This could be due to an object that is not in the lock or a misaligned strike plate, or even simply an old key. Try using compressed air to eliminate dust or dirt from the lock. You can also use graphite or another dry lubricant to turn the key smoothly. We recommend against lubricants that contain oil since they tend to attract dirt over time.
A misaligned strikeplate is a different common cause. This can be fixed by loosening screws and then adjusting plate position so that it aligns with the hole of the latch. If this fails, you can also try tightening the hinges, and then adjusting the latch so that it is positioned more comfortably against the frame.
A frame or door that is not aligned could also result in a locking mechanism that is not aligned. This could be due to environmental factors like humidity exposure and temperature fluctuations, causing the frame to shift or become uneven over time. This can cause the strike plate to become out of alignment with the locking point.

Broken Locks
Locks can stop working due to wear and tears. This is especially common with lower-quality locks that are more prone to damage from environmental elements and heavy usage. If you notice that your lock is malfunctioning, it's vital to call a professional locksmith for repairs as soon as possible. This will ensure that the repair is completed swiftly and efficiently.
A damaged lock can be caused by environmental factors, like extreme weather conditions or poor construction. To avoid this, you should select a lock that has the ability to endure the elements and is built to last. You can also prolong the lifespan of your locks by lubricating and cleaning them regularly.
Another common issue that affects conservatory doors is a faulty handle mechanism. The issue can be easily solved by tightening the screws on the handle of the door with a screwdriver. If you are unable to resolve the problem on your own, you can also try an oil-lubricating spray or silicone oil to prevent the mechanism from becoming stuck.
In some instances it could be the accumulation of dirt or grime that's making it difficult to open the lock. In these cases, you can use a cotton swab to get rid of dirt and grime. If this does nothing, you can try lubricating your lock using a graphite spray or silicone spray.

Damaged Locks
Over time, locks can be affected by various forms of damage. This could be due to wear and tear, misalignment, or even environmental factors. A damaged lock can be difficult to open or latch, and could be a convenient entry point for burglars. This kind of damage is usually repaired by an experienced locksmith.
One of the most common problems with the conservatory door is that the handle can become loose. This could make it difficult to latch the door and can also cause the handle to spin around in place when trying to lock the door. This can cause the door mechanism to be damaged and, in some situations, it could break.
When a lock is damaged, it is important to call a professional locksmith immediately. The locksmith will examine the lock and determine if it is damaged beyond repair or if it requires replacement wooden conservatory doors completely. The locksmith will then put in the new lock, and make sure it is a perfect fit.
Locks can be affected by many issues like key breakage or a lack of lubrication. The accumulation of dirt and debris can cause problems within the lock mechanism, making it difficult to insert a key or turn it easily. This can be prevented by cleaning and lubricating the lock regularly. Extreme weather conditions can cause damage to locks, so keeping them safe from exposure to moisture and extreme heat or cold can prolong their life span.
Another common problem with uPVC door locks is that they can be frozen in very cold temperatures. This can make it difficult to open the door. However, it is easy to fix by placing the key on an iron or in hot water prior to inserting it.

Lost Keys
If you lose your keys, you'll need new keys made or have your locks replaced. This is usually done by a locksmith who will usually charge a call-out fee. They'll also have to know the door's brand and model and any identifying numbers. These are in the handle or on the barrel of the lock.
If the lock is damaged in some way, and it won't accept the key, you may be able to get rid of debris from the lock's locking mechanism. You can do this with thin wires, such as guitar string or fishing line. If this fails, the best option is to find an expert locksmith to reset the lock and give you a new key.
If you are unable to locate your keys, you may have had them cut incorrectly. If this is the case, then take the key and lock to a locksmith who can create a new key for you, if they know the exact number of your original. This will ensure that your new key is created to the exact same specifications as your original and won't break the lock.
